Analog Sea

Analog Sea is an offline publisher who values the relationship between authors, publishers, booksellers and readers. Therefore, they work hard to distribute their books through the physical bookstores they love and support.

Editor Jonathan Simons candidly discloses, "In the Internet age, we never catch up. We are perpetually lagging behind and haven't even the time to wonder how else to live our lives."

"The Analog Sea Review" is a brilliant English story & essay collection that allows you to pause, reassess life and rediscover the world of imagination.
